AI Summary

  • Amends the Age of Majority Act of 1971 to clarify that individuals 18 years of age or older have the same legal rights, duties, and capacities as individuals who were 21 years of age before January 1, 1972.

  • Updates statutory references in the act to use modern citation format (e.g., "1966 PA 138" instead of "Act No. 138 of the Public Acts of 1966") for consistency and clarity.

  • Specifies that courts may order support payments for individuals 18 years of age or older under provisions of five separate acts relating to family support, child custody, paternity, and spousal support.

  • Establishes exemptions from the age of majority provisions for the Michigan Regulation and Taxation of Marihuana Act and the nicotine and tobacco act.

  • Takes effect only upon enactment of Senate Bill No. ____ or House Bill No. 6002 of the 102nd Legislature.

Legislative Description

Tobacco: other; reference to 1915 PA 31 in the age of majority act of 1971; revise. Amends secs. 2 & 3 of 1971 PA 79 (MCL 722.52 & 722.53).
